On day 2 of the RiverRun International Film Festival, we sat down with filmmaker @willthwaites to discuss the documentary film @crimeandparody which he wrote, directed, filmed, and co-edited. "Crime + Parody" begins with an account of Anthony Novak's legal conflict with his local police department in Parma, Ohio and expands to cover the story of another Ohio resident, Omar Arrington Bay, whose encounters with law enforcement ultimately led to his death. Along the way, the film addresses issues like freedom of speech, the importance of comedy as a check on governmental power, and the controversial legal principle of qualified immunity.       In addition to discussing the film, we also talked with Will about his career in the film industry, which has included projects as varied as Animal Planet's "Zoo" and James Cameron's "The Story of Science Fiction." "Crime + Parody" is his feature length directorial debut, and has already won him an award for best Director (at the Atlanta Documentary Film Festival) during its festival run. This past week Richard had the privilege of sitting down for a conversation with Michael Morin, the new Executive Director of the RiverRun International Film Festival.      Michael hails from California, where he grew up loving both music and movies, though music was his first love. After attending Junior college and film school in California, he began the first phase of his multi-faceted career which saw him touring with bands, filming concerts, and, eventually, working as an assistant to filmmaker David O. Russell, who directed The Fighter, Silver Linings Playbook, and American Hustle, among other films. After taking some time off from working in and around Hollywood, the film industry came calling Michael again, but this from a different place - the world of Film Festivals. Specifically, the Slamdance Film Festival, which was based in Park City, Utah at the time.
